2018 AFN to ETB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2018

During 2018, the AFN to ETB ex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on November 18, valuing the pair at 0.4345.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on September 16, dropping to 0.3629.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0715 ETB.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.3934 to the December average rate of 0.3730, the exchange rate registered a net change of -5.17%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2018 high of 0.4345 was up 8.53% compared to the 2017 peak of 0.4003,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 0.3965 0.3870 0.3934
February 0.3991 0.3934 0.3965
March 0.3977 0.3944 0.3959
April 0.3978 0.3901 0.3927
May 0.3918 0.3829 0.3872
June 0.3866 0.3762 0.3840
July 0.3861 0.3739 0.3784
August 0.3838 0.3756 0.3800
September 0.3762 0.3629 0.3698
October 0.3729 0.3638 0.3681
November 0.4345 0.3667 0.3720
December 0.3787 0.3675 0.3730
